Abstract
We prove that the generalised non-crossing partitions associated to well-generated complex reflection groups of exceptional type obey two different cyclic sieving phenomena, as conjectured by Armstrong, respectively by Bessis and Reiner. This manuscript accompanies the paper "Cyclic sieving for generalised non-crossing partitions associated to complex reflection groups of exceptional type" [arXiv:1001.0028], for which it provides the computational details.
